The Cost of Stem Cell Therapy

Numerous variables contribute to the price of stem cell therapy. The kind of condition being treated, the severity of the case, and the site of the treatment center can all influence the overall price. For instance, therapies for more serious conditions typically require a greater quantity of cells and lengthy treatment periods, resulting higher costs.

Fortunately, there are a variety of financing options available to help patients access stem cell therapy. Some health plans may partially cover the price of certain therapies, while others offer adjustable payment schedules. Patients can also explore financing options such as loans or budgeting plans to make treatment more affordable. It's always best to speak with your physician and the treatment center directly to clarify the specific prices involved and available payment options.

Understanding the Expense of Stem Cell Treatment: What to Expect and How to Prepare

Stem cell treatment offers immense potential for addressing a wide range of diseases. However, the financial burden of these treatments can be substantial, often forcing patients to carefully consider their options.

Before undertaking stem cell treatment, it is essential to acquire a thorough understanding of the associated costs.

Factors that can impact the overall expenditure include:

* The kind of stem cells used

* The complexity of the illness being addressed

* The length of the treatment protocol

* The location where the treatment is carried out

* Any additional costs, such as transportation and pharmaceutical products.
